According to the 2011 Census of India, the Census village code mapped to the Jandi (690) village in Gurdaspur Taluka is 027876. This village is located in the Gurdaspur Taluka of Gurdaspur district in Punjab state of India. The village is comes under Jandi Gram Panchayat of Punjab. The pincode of Jandi (690) village is 143531.

The total geographical area of Jandi (690) village is 347 hectares.

The total population of Jandi (690) village is 1981 peoples, in which 945 are male and 1036 are female. This village sex ratio is 91.
